these old skates
 bent crease whisper webwork a lattice on leather
            the varicose black language of wear
 bend the tongue
               orr parka oval frame an Inuk fur smile
               skates ain’t scruffy no more
 they’re Bauers
                     the coolest til fat Jimmy
                     bought himself a pair
 they’re yours
                      cold cracked stick memory
                      kicked the puck up for a score
